Sept. 2, 2008
Columbia, Mo. – A pair of Mizzou football standouts were honored Tuesday for their play in the 6th-ranked Tigers' 52-42 season-opening win over 20th-ranked Illinois last weekend. Senior DE Stryker Sulak (Rockdale, Texas) and sophomore WR/KR/PR Jeremy Maclin (Kirkwood, Mo.) were named the Big 12 Conference Defensive and Special Teams Player of the Week, respectively, as announced by the league office.
Sulak was cited for his outstanding performance that saw him wreak havoc in the Illini backfield all night long Saturday in the Edward Jones Dome. Sulak was credited with five tackles for loss, including three quarterback sacks. He also forced a fumble and blocked an extra point, to add to his eight overall tackles. Sulak had the most tackles for loss, as well as most quarterback sacks, in the NCAA in week one, as he stands on top of the charts in both categories nationally heading into Saturday's game against Southeast Missouri State. This is the first Big 12 weekly honor for Sulak, who was a 2nd-Team All-Big 12 pick in 2007 by both league coaches and media.
Maclin was honored for his game-changing performance on special teams Saturday, which featured a 99-yard kickoff return for a touchdown against the Illini that came just :13 seconds after Illinois had taken its only lead of the game. Maclin's touchdown made it 17-13 in favor of MU in the 2nd quarter, and the Tigers never looked back. The 2007 consensus 1st-Team All-American return man also had a 46-yard punt return in the 3rd quarter that he nearly took the distance, and which eventually set up another Tiger score that upped MU's advantage to 45-20. Maclin had 234 all-purpose yards for the game, including 145 yards in kickoff returns, and 56 yards in punt returns, to go with 33 yards from scrimmage (31 receiving, 2 rushing). This marks the third time that Maclin has won the weekly Big 12 Special Teams award, after he took it home twice in 2007, for performances against Illinois State and Kansas State.
